Fusion 360 cant toolpath 1/4" hole

I’m trying to make a mounting bracket that needs some 1/4" holes and I keep getting errors on the toolpath for just these small holes. The rest of the part is fine. Does anyone know what I might have done wrong? I’ve attached a list of the errors. I have tried changing the lead in/ Lead out and the cut offset.

You are on the right track, I think. Try a 3mm straight lead in so it starts in the center of the hole.

What thickness of material? Even if you get it to try and cut you may be chasing your tail if the material is too thick for such a small hole and hope to get a clean cut.

Too long a lead in especially with a 90 deg lead can be an issue.
Pierce height can also cause it to skip a feature if it’s too small, depending on your kerf setting. Either set pierce to 0 and set it to what you want on the Droid.

I finally got it. It seems the problem was my 1/16" overlap at the end of the cut. I also changed lead in angle to 90 deg from 60. Lowered the pierce height, reduced the kerf size and ultimately had to do it as a center cut. I also had to draw the piece in 3d showing that it was 1/8 thick.

Jim this was 1/8" aluminum.
